Instructions

  • 1 - Boil Potatoes:
    Peel and chop the potatoes. Boil in salted water until fork-tender.
  • 2 - Mash Potatoes:
    Drains the potatoes and mash them with salt, black pepper, chili powder, cumin, and lemon juice.
  • 3 - Prepare Taco Shells:
    Warm the taco shells in a pan for a few minutes until soft or crispy.
  • 4 - Fill Taco Shells:
    Spoon the mashed potato filling into each taco shell.
  • 5 - Garnish and Serve:
    Top with chopped onions and cilantro. Serve hot!

Taco de Papa: A Divine Fusion of Flavors

Taco de Papa is a savory taco centered around a unique potato filling. Originating in the heart of Mexican cuisine, this refreshing vegetarian twist balances the soft texture of mashed potatoes with savory spices that are often found in traditional taco fillings. The dish epitomizes the idea of comfort food yet allows for significant flexibility based on personal taste.

Creating Taco de Papa starts with boiling and mashing the potatoes, incorporating a medley of spices like cumin and chili powder. These seasonings provide depth and richness, ensuring each bite is packed with flavor. The vibrant colors of fresh vegetables like cilantro and onion not only enhance flavor but add an aesthetic appeal.

From a cultural perspective, this dish highlights the resourcefulness seen in vast culinary traditions worldwide, including Mexican cuisine, where using locally available ingredients spins a beautiful dish of comfort that is easy to make.

Tips for Creating the Perfect Taco de Papa:

  • Choose starchy potatoes for a smooth mash. Butter or vegan alternatives can enhance the flavor further.
  • Explore variations by adding cheese or black beans to the potato filling for an extra protein kick.
  • Don’t shy away from elevating the taco with sauces such as a queso or avocado salsa.
